During the Christmas season, Lisbon comes alive with vibrant markets and illuminated streets. Walk through Baixa, where Rua Augusta is spectacularly lit, leading to the grand Praça do Comércio, often home to a large Christmas tree. For a more traditional experience, visit the Christmas fair in Campo Pequeno, offering artisan crafts and Portuguese delicacies. New Year's Eve in Lisbon is particularly special, with fireworks illuminating the Tagus River from various viewpoints, most notably from the Miradouro da Senhora do Monte or the Miradouro de São Pedro de Alcântara. We can coordinate access to premium viewing spots, ensuring an unforgettable start to the new year.

Beyond Lisbon, consider a day trip to Óbidos, a medieval walled town that transforms into a Christmas village, complete with ice skating and Santa's house. Or venture to the Alentejo region, just an hour's drive from Lisbon, to experience a more tranquil, rural Christmas. Here, you might find local traditions like the 'Ceia de Natal' (Christmas supper) celebrated with hearty dishes such as 'Bacalhau de Consoada' (codfish with potatoes and cabbage).
